How they compare

Eastern Africa currently reports 248,830 LSU against 88,546 LSU in Dominican Republic, a difference of 160,284 LSU.

That makes Eastern Africa's figure about 2.8 times Dominican Republic's.

Across all 63 years both countries report, Eastern Africa has been ahead every year.

Dominican Republic ranks 12th and Eastern Africa ranks 14th of 81 countries.

Eastern Africa has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

The Livestock Patterns domain of FAOSTAT contains data on livestock numbers, shares of major livestock species and densities of livestock units in the agricultural land area. Values are calculated using Livestock Units (LSU), which facilitate aggregating information for different livestock types. Data are available by country, with global coverage, for the period 1961 to the most recent year available with annual updates. This methodology applies the LSU coefficients reported in the "Guidelines for the preparation of livestock sector reviews" (FAO, 2011). From this publication, LSU coefficients are computed by livestock type and by country. The reference unit used for the calculation of livestock units (=1 LSU) is the grazing equivalent of one adult dairy cow producing 3000 kg of milk annually, fed without additional concentrated foodstuffs. FAOSTAT agri-environmental indicators on livestock patterns closely follow the structure of the indicators in EUROSTAT.
